public static void AddStrengthsWithSameDirection(this ItemsConnecter connecter, int[] strenghts, Direction direction) { foreach (var strength in strenghts) { connecter.AddItem(strength, direction); } }
public void GetSortedItems_ReturnsCorrectCountItemsOnSecondConnecter_WhenFirstConnectersHasOwnItems() { connecter.AddItem(1, Direction.Right); connecter.AddItem(1, Direction.Left); var secondConnecter = new ItemsConnecter(); for (var index = 0; index < 1000; index++) { secondConnecter.AddItem(1, Direction.Right); secondConnecter.AddItem(1, Direction.Left); } secondConnecter.GetSortedConneсtions().Should().HaveCount(1000); }
public void SetUp() { connecter = new ItemsConnecter(); }